E Mini Future Trading – the Pros and Cons
Because the benefits of day trading align so closely with those of futures trading, this list covers both:
The benefits:
- Work from any location with a high speed internet connection – no geographic restraint.
- Low overhead costs – a little equipment, a connection, a desk in the spare room.

- Volatility in the stock market generally can be very frustrating to the short or long term investor and may result in frequent losses or very reduced gains. Volatility in day trading is the trader’s friend (most of the time) and E-mini futures will track the volatility closely.
- Low initial capital required – this advantage is unique to internet day trading of futures trading – if you day trade stocks, ETFs or options you will need a minimum of $25,000 in your account. See my post “How much money do I need to start?”
- Gains can be made when the market is going up, down or sideways. (See day trading techniques)
The disadvantages:
- Day trading is a ruthless pursuit which endeavors to gain from causing the other person to lose. You can be on the wrong side of this equation.
- Day traders need to have or develop a unique psychological approach to actions and situations which otherwise could cause health-damaging stress. (See good day trading advice – the right mindset). Trading e mini futures is best approached by applying certain mechanical emini trading systems which provide predetermined entry and exit point strategies and which therefore take the emotions of fear and greed out of the process. The removal of these emotions enables the trader to be mentally on a par with the professional who is also trading with preset plans and not “by the seat of the pants”.
